Purpose : This study was designed to demonstrate the potential therapeutic advantage
of 3-dimensional (3-D) treatment planning over the conventional 2-dimensional (2-D)
approach in patients with carcinoma of the nasopharynx.
Materials and Methods : The two techniques were compared both qualitatively and
quantitatively for the boost portion of the treatment (19.8 Gy of a total 70.2 Gy
treatment schedule) in patient with T4. The comparisons between 2-D and 3-D plans
were made using dose statistics, dose-volume histogram, tumor control probabilities. and
normal tissue complication probabilities.
Results : The 3-D treatment planning improved the dose homogeneity in the planning
target volume. In addition. it caused the mean dose of the planning target volume to
increase by 15.2% over 2-D planning. The mean dose to normal structures such as the
temporal lobe, brain stem, carotid gland, and temporomandibular joint was reduced with
the 3-0 plan. The probability of tumor control was increased by 6% with 3-D treatment
planning compared to the 2-D planning, while the probability of normal tissue
complication was reduced.
Conclusion : This study demonstrated the potential advantage of increasing the tumor
control by using 3-D planning, but prospective studies are required to define the true
clinical benefit.
